Last night’s Creative Arts Emmy award winners included Dan Castellaneta, as Homer Simpson (Father Knows Worst, The Simpsons), for the Outstanding Voice-Over award meaning that Family Guy‘s Seth MacFarlane missed out on this year’s award. Seth was nominated for his work as Peter Griffin in the season 7 episode I Dream of Jesus....

Seth MacFarlane, creator of Family Guy, American Dad and The Cleveland Show, says his “perfect scenario” would be to do the show for “another couple of years and then wrap it up.” “I don’t want to go 20 years like The Simpsons,” Seth told Sun Media. “Ideally we would go another couple of years and then wrap it up.
